英文编号在asp网站上显示为波斯语

时间:2017-11-12 19:23:45

标签: css asp.net-mvc font-face multilingual persian

您好,我有一个多语言网站(英语和波斯语)。我使用font face来显示不同语言的不同字体。如果我在我的字体表面添加一个波斯字体,所有数字,包括英文页面中的英文数字显示为波斯数字,如果我只使用英文字体,所有数字都以英文显示。 我该怎么办?

@font-face {
font-family: 'myNazanin';
    src: 
    local('B Nazanin'),
    url('../fonts/BNazanin.eot') format('eot'),  /* IE6–8 */
    url('../fonts/BNazanin.woff') format('woff'),  /* FF3.6+, IE9, Chrome6+, 
    Saf5.1+*/
    url('../fonts/BNazanin.ttf') format('truetype');
 }
 @font-face {
   font-family: 'my New Roman';
     src: 
    local('Times New Roman'),

 }
 body{

   font-family:myNazanin,'my New Roman';
 }

1 个答案:

答案 0 :(得分:0)

它解决了!我的波斯语字体不是网络的标准字体!我将其改为标准字体,现在一切正常!